THE PHANTOM:
LAW OF THE JUNGLE


 

Story: Joe Gentile
Art: Paul Guinan

72pgs, COLOR, squarebound, $11.99

Rated PG-13

Moonstone’s first WIDE VISION book!

Every page is a double page spread, sandwiched by prose!

Readers rejoice! This format is not a five minute read!

Every society has its laws: some written, some unwritten-for some are forbidden to be even spoken aloud.

These are the laws that get passed on from one generation to the next.

The penalty for breaking these laws is often swift and uncompromising.

Combine the lack of this knowledge with the unhinged mind of a deadly assassin who is calling out the PHANTOM, and you get nothing but fire.

Bang the drum for Paul Guinan’s (“Chronos”) painted art, which has an eerie cinematic quality that ignites a wanton rhthym into the night of the Bangalla jungle.
